Understanding the Foundation of High-Converting Lead Generation

Every successful marketing strategy starts with a deep understanding of lead generation basics. High-Converting Lead Generation is about more than getting names into your CRM. It means attracting the right people, engaging them meaningfully, and guiding them into action. In other words, putting quality ahead of quantity is essential for smart business growth.

Historically, lead generation was simple. Cold calls, trade shows, and basic ads were enough. However, today’s buyers are savvy, connected, and expect personalized experiences. As a result, marketers must be more strategic and data-driven than ever before.

Key Elements of High-Converting Lead Generation

So, what separates good campaigns from great ones? Here are the most important elements:

  • Clear targeting: Knowing exactly who you want to reach.
  • Compelling offers: Giving prospects a reason to engage.
  • Personalized communication: Speaking to their needs and pain points.
  • Strong calls-to-action (CTAs): Making the next step obvious and easy.
  • Fast response time: Following up quickly builds trust and momentum.

Each part must work together. Otherwise, potential leads slip through the cracks. For example, even the best ad won’t convert if the call-to-action is confusing or hidden.

Best Channels for High-Converting Lead Generation

Choosing the right channels is crucial. Not all platforms work equally well for every industry. However, certain approaches consistently deliver results when done properly:

  • Email Marketing: Personalized, timely emails can nurture leads effectively over time.
  • Social Media Campaigns: Platforms like LinkedIn and Facebook allow for hyper-targeted outreach.
  • Search Engine Optimization (SEO): Ranking highly for the right keywords drives organic traffic.
  • Pay-Per-Click (PPC) Advertising: Well-crafted ads put your offer in front of ready-to-act searchers.
  • Webinars and Events: Offering valuable content builds authority and trust quickly.

For instance, SaaS companies often find that a webinar followed by customized emails leads to stronger engagement rates. Meanwhile, e-commerce brands might lean heavily on paid social ads with enticing discount offers.

Optimizing Your Funnel for High-Converting Lead Generation

Lead generation is just the first step. Therefore, optimizing the funnel ensures that leads don’t fizzle out before becoming clients or buyers. Here’s how to do that effectively:

  • Landing Pages: Create single-purpose pages with no distractions and a clear next step.
  • Lead Magnets: Offer value upfront to encourage form submissions (e.g., ebooks, templates, consults).
  • CRM and Automation: Use technology to track leads and send timely follow-ups automatically.
  • Qualification Systems: Score leads based on actions and demographics to prioritize outreach.

To clarify, failing to optimize the sales funnel typically results in high dropout rates and wasted spend. A robust nurturing sequence can increase conversion rates by up to 80%, according to industry studies by HubSpot.

Common Mistakes That Sabotage High-Converting Lead Generation

Even the best-intentioned marketers can make mistakes that derail results. Most importantly, spotting and fixing these issues early saves time and money:

  • Generic messaging: Speaking to everyone often connects with no one.
  • Slow follow-up: Leads go cold quickly without prompt communication.
  • Overlooking mobile optimization: A bad mobile experience kills conversions fast.
  • Ignoring analytics: Without data, it’s impossible to make informed improvements.

Consequently, reviewing campaign performance weekly — not monthly — allows for faster pivots and better results over time.

Real-World Example of High-Converting Lead Generation in Action

Let’s consider a practical case: A B2B SaaS company offering project management tools wanted to scale its user base. Firstly, they invested in personalized LinkedIn ad campaigns targeting CIOs and project managers. Secondly, they built a landing page offering a free demo request form.

After that, leads received an automated email sequence offering case studies, testimonials, and bonus trial extensions. Consequently, conversion rates grew from 7% to 23% within four months — a remarkable 228% increase. This success highlights why integrating personalization, automation, and user-centered design is vital for High-Converting Lead Generation.

Emerging Trends Shaping the Future of Lead Generation

Meanwhile, the landscape evolves constantly. Smart brands actively monitor and adapt to emerging trends. Some forces that are making waves include:

  • AI and Machine Learning: Smarter algorithms predict buyer behavior and personalize at scale.
  • Voice Search Optimization: Conversational searches are growing with smart assistants.
  • Video Marketing: Video content converts much higher than static content in many industries.
  • Interactive Content: Quizzes, calculators, and self-assessments drive deeper engagement.
  • First-Party Data Focus: Privacy regulations are making direct data collection critical.

In the same vein, companies who prioritize these shifts will stay competitive, while slower adopters risk falling behind.

FAQ About High-Converting Lead Generation

What is the quickest way to boost High-Converting Lead Generation?

Improving your offer is often the fastest route. A compelling offer that resonates emotionally and logically moves people to action faster than tweaks to design or copy alone.

How much should I invest in High-Converting Lead Generation?

That depends on customer lifetime value (LTV) and acquisition costs. However, businesses typically allocate 7–12% of total revenue to marketing, with a strong portion going to lead generation efforts.

Can automation really improve High-Converting Lead Generation?

Absolutely. Intelligent automation — like behavior-triggered emails and smart retargeting ads — reduces manual work and increases nurturing effectiveness without feeling impersonal.

Why is personalization crucial for High-Converting Lead Generation?

Personalized campaigns connect faster because they feel relevant and genuine. Higher relevance leads to increased trust, which, in turn, leads to higher conversions.
